Aerobic and Anaerobic Exercises
Generally, there are two types of exercises:
- Aerobic
- Anaerobic
Aerobic exercises are those in which the patient spends calories from nutrient sources.
Examples of aerobic exercises are:
- bicycling
- jogging (running)Life Style Modification
- treadmill
- swimming
- brisk walking
- dancing
Anaerobic exercises are of short duration, there is increased physical activity and gets the energy sources from muscles. Examples of anaerobic exercises are:
- Weight lifting
- Muscular exercises
